Lady Bulldogs Top Blue Mountain For Conference Win

JACKSON, Tenn. - 2/10/2005 - The 91±¬ÁÏÍø Lady Bulldogs defeated Blue Mountain College (Miss.) 76-60 on Thursday night. The seventh ranked Lady Bulldogs improved to 23-3 overall and 4-3 in league play. Blue Mountain fell to 9-11 overall and 2-6 in the conference.

91±¬ÁÏÍø jumped out to a 41-20 halftime lead in the game with the help of 6-fo-16 (.375) shooting from behind the arc in the first half. In the second half, 91±¬ÁÏÍø failed to make a three pointer (0-7) and shot just .361 from the field. Blue Mountain cut the lead to 12 points with just under seven minutes to play, but 91±¬ÁÏÍø surged back for the 16-point win.

The Lady Bulldogs were led by Stephanie Clark with 25 points and 17 rebounds. Merideth Richardson scored 15 points on 4-of-7 shooting from behind the arc. Natanya Smith added 14 points for 91±¬ÁÏÍø. Blue Mountain was led by Sheree McDowell with 19 points and 14 rebounds while Prescilla Berry tallied 18 points.
